I have a nice old 12' vhull that I want to use when I fish by myself. Want to move to the middle seat to help with weight distribution. Don't have a front platform, just the bench seats.  

How could I mount a small trolling motor to the side of this boat? Anyone have an idea for a mount that would let me just clamp the motor on the side of the boat under the gunwale rim. It would be just a few feet back from the bow.  Can you take a trolling motor and reverse the head 180 degrees so it could be operated in front of you rather than behind as it is when it is bolted to the back transom?

Any ideas.  Right now I don't want to build a front casting platform even though that would probably be the ideal thing.  The center seat would be just fine.
